Lehrgebiet InformationssystemeFB Informatik |
||
|
Introducing Custom Language Extensions to SQL:1999Jernej Kovse, Wolfgang MahnkeUniversity of KaiserslauternDept. of Computer Science (AG DBIS) P.O. Box 3049, 67653 Kaiserslautern, Germany e-mail: {kovse, mahnke}@informatik.uni-kl.de Full paper (PDF version)AbstractEven though SQL has become widely accepted as a language for implementing relational database schemas and querying data, there are cases where its users experience the need for new language abstractions which would allow them to express data modeling and querying solutions in a clearer and simpler manner. This paper describes the idea of language extensions to SQL:1999 that come in form of independent packages and may be implemented by different vendors. A translator systems uses information imported from the packages to translate the statements containing the extensions into SQL:1999-compliant statements.in: Proc. 15th Conf. on Advanced Information Systems Engineering (CAiSE'03), Klagenfurt/Velden, June 2003, pp. 193-208. |